Three plumbers looked at this job and said no. I said yes.
Our client wasn't chasing a whole new look. He just wanted more storage in his bathroom, and a small wall-hung basin wasn't giving him what he needed day to day.
So the plan was simple enough. Take out the little basin and put in a proper vanity with drawers. More bench, more storage, and a fresh set of tapware to finish it off.
Simple, except he'd already had three plumbers out and every one of them knocked it back. They'd happily swap the taps over, but nobody wanted to touch the vanity or anything beyond that.
It wasn't that the job couldn't be done. It's that it was a unit in a high rise, and a lot of plumbers just don't want to do it. The access, the shut offs, the extra bits that come with it. So they steer clear of the makeover and stick to the easy stuff.
That's the part worth knowing. A bathroom makeover in a unit isn't a harder job. It just needs someone who's done plenty of them and isn't put off by the building.
We put in a new vanity with proper drawer storage, updated the tapware, and plumbed it all in. Same tiles, same layout. He just ended up with the bathroom he actually wanted.
